
aam-opencv
The Active Appearance Model (AAM) is a generalisation of the widely used Active Shape Model approach, but uses all the information in the image region covered by the target object, rather than just that near modelled edges.
An AAM contains a statistical model of the shape and grey-level appearance of the object of interest which can generalise to almost any valid example. Matching to an image involves finding model parameters which minimise the difference between the image and a synthesised model example, projected into the image. The potentially large number of parameters makes this a difficult problem.
